<refentry id="function.mysqli-fetch-row">
<refnamediv>
<refname>mysqli_fetch_row</refname>
<refname>result->fetch_row</refname>
<refpurpose>Get a result row as an enumerated array</refpurpose>
</refnamediv>
<refsect1>
<title>Description</title>
<para>Procedural style:</para>
<methodsynopsis>
<type>mixed</type><methodname>mysqli_fetch_row</methodname>
<methodparam><type>object</type><parameter>result</parameter></methodparam>
</methodsynopsis>
<para>Object oriented style (method):</para>
<classsynopsis>
<ooclass><classname>result</classname></ooclass>
<methodsynopsis>
<type>mixed</type>
<methodname>fetch_row</methodname>
<methodparam><type>void</type><parameter></parameter></methodparam>
</methodsynopsis>
</classsynopsis>
<para>
Returns an array that corresponds to the fetched row, or &false; if there are no more rows.
</para>
<para>
<function>mysqli_fetch_row</function> fetches one row of data from the result set represented by
<parameter>result</parameter> and returns it as an enumerated array, where each column is stored
in an array offset starting from 0 (zero). Each subsequent call to the
<function>mysqli_fetch_row</function> function will return the next row within the result set,
or &false; if there are no more rows.
</para>
</refsect1>
<refsect1>
<title>Return values</title>
<para>
<function>mysqli_fetch_row</function> returns an array that corresponds to the fetched row
or &null; if there are no more rows in result set.
</para>

<refsect1>
<title>Example</title>
<para>
<example>
<title>Object oriented style</title>
<programlisting role='php'>
<![CDATA[
<?php
$mysqli = new mysqli("localhost", "my_user", "my_password", "test");
$mysqli->query( "DROP TABLE IF EXISTS friends");
$mysqli->query( "CREATE TABLE friends (id int, name varchar(20))");
$mysqli->query( "INSERT INTO friends VALUES (1,'Hartmut'), (2, 'Ulf')");
$result = $mysqli->query( "SELECT id, name FROM friends");
/* fetch object */
$row = $result->fetch_row();
printf("Id: %d Name: %s\n", $row[0], $row[1]);
$result->close();
$mysqli->close();
?>
]]>
</programlisting>
</example>
<example>
<title>Procedural style</title>
<programlisting role='php'>
<![CDATA[
<?php
$link = mysqli_connect("localhost", "my_user", "my_password", "test");
mysqli_query($link, "DROP TABLE IF EXISTS friends");
mysqli_query($link, "CREATE TABLE friends (id int, name varchar(20))");
mysqli_query($link, "INSERT INTO friends VALUES (1,'Hartmut'), (2, 'Ulf')");
$result = mysqli_query($link, "SELECT id, name FROM friends");
/* fetch object */
$row = mysqli_fetch_row($result);
printf("Id: %d Name: %s\n", $row[0], $row[1]);
mysqli_free_result($result);
mysqli_close($link);
?>
]]>
</programlisting>
</example>
</para>
</refsect1>
